Industry Applications of Fiber Laser Cutting Machines in Modern Manufacturing
Fiber laser cutting machines have rapidly transformed modern manufacturing industries by offering high precision, fast processing speeds, and excellent adaptability across a wide range of materials. As global production demands continue to increase, traditional cutting methods such as mechanical punching, plasma cutting, and flame cutting are gradually being replaced by fiber laser technology.
The reason behind this shift is simple. Fiber laser cutting delivers cleaner edges, higher efficiency, lower operating costs, and greater flexibility in production. These advantages make it a key technology across industries such as automotive manufacturing, aerospace engineering, sheet metal fabrication, electronics, construction, and customized metal processing.
Understanding how fiber laser cutting machines are applied in different industries helps manufacturers better evaluate their investment decisions and maximize production efficiency.
Sheet Metal Fabrication Industry
The sheet metal fabrication industry is one of the largest application areas for fiber laser cutting machines. This industry requires high-speed processing of metal sheets into panels, brackets, enclosures, and structural components used in a wide range of products.
Fiber laser technology allows fabricators to achieve precise cutting with minimal material waste. It also supports complex geometries that are difficult or impossible to achieve using traditional mechanical tools. As a result, manufacturers can produce high-quality parts with consistent accuracy and reduced secondary processing.
In modern sheet metal workshops, fiber laser cutting machines have become the core production equipment, replacing traditional punching machines and significantly improving workflow efficiency.
Automotive Manufacturing Industry
The automotive industry relies heavily on precision, consistency, and high-volume production. Fiber laser cutting machines are widely used in this sector for producing body panels, chassis components, brackets, and various precision metal parts.
One of the key advantages in automotive applications is the ability to maintain tight tolerances while processing large volumes of materials. Fiber laser cutting ensures smooth edges and high repeatability, which are essential for vehicle safety and performance standards.
In addition, the flexibility of laser cutting allows manufacturers to quickly adapt to new vehicle designs without the need for expensive tooling changes, making it ideal for both mass production and prototype development.
Aerospace and Aviation Industry
In aerospace manufacturing, precision and material performance are critical. Fiber laser cutting machines are used to process high-strength alloys such as titanium, stainless steel, and aluminum components used in aircraft structures and engine systems.
The non-contact cutting process reduces mechanical stress on materials, ensuring structural integrity and reliability. This is especially important in aerospace applications where even minor defects can affect safety and performance.
Fiber laser technology also supports the production of complex geometries required in aerospace engineering, allowing manufacturers to achieve high precision while maintaining material efficiency.
Electronics and Electrical Industry
The electronics industry requires extremely fine and precise metal components used in devices, circuit enclosures, connectors, and heat dissipation systems. Fiber laser cutting machines are widely used for producing these small and intricate parts.
The high beam quality of fiber lasers allows for micro-level precision cutting, ensuring clean edges and accurate dimensions. This is essential for electronic components where space is limited and accuracy is critical.
In addition, fiber laser cutting supports rapid prototyping and small-batch production, making it highly suitable for the fast-paced innovation cycles of the electronics industry.
Construction and Structural Engineering
The construction industry also benefits significantly from fiber laser cutting technology. It is widely used for processing structural steel components, metal frames, support beams, and architectural metalwork.
Fiber laser cutting enables faster production of construction materials with high accuracy and consistency. This helps reduce on-site adjustments and improves overall construction efficiency.
Architectural designers also benefit from the technology’s ability to produce decorative metal panels, custom designs, and complex structural elements that enhance modern building aesthetics.
Kitchenware and Home Appliance Manufacturing
Fiber laser cutting machines play an important role in the production of kitchen equipment, home appliances, and stainless steel products. These include ovens, cabinets, sinks, panels, and decorative components.
The technology ensures smooth surface finishes and precise dimensions, which are essential for both functional performance and visual appearance. Manufacturers can achieve high consistency in mass production while also supporting customized product designs.
The ability to quickly switch between designs makes fiber laser cutting ideal for appliance manufacturers that operate in competitive and design-driven markets.
Advertising and Decorative Metal Industry
The advertising and decorative metal industry relies heavily on precision cutting for signage, logos, and artistic metal designs. Fiber laser cutting machines are widely used to create detailed and visually appealing products.
This industry benefits greatly from the flexibility of laser cutting, as it allows designers to produce complex shapes and intricate patterns with ease. Materials such as stainless steel, aluminum, and brass are commonly used for high-end signage and decorative applications.
The precision and smooth finishing of fiber laser cutting also reduce the need for polishing or additional processing, improving production efficiency.
Agricultural Machinery Industry
Agricultural machinery manufacturing requires durable and strong metal components that can withstand harsh working environments. Fiber laser cutting machines are used to produce structural parts, machine frames, and mechanical components for agricultural equipment.
The ability to process thick metal sheets with high accuracy ensures that parts meet strict durability and performance requirements. Fiber laser cutting also helps manufacturers reduce production time and improve consistency across large-scale production runs.
Metal Furniture and Custom Fabrication
Metal furniture production is another growing application area for fiber laser cutting technology. It is used to manufacture frames, decorative elements, support structures, and customized furniture designs.
The flexibility of laser cutting allows designers to create modern and artistic furniture styles with high precision. This supports the growing demand for customized and aesthetic metal furniture in both residential and commercial markets.
Custom fabrication workshops also rely heavily on fiber laser cutting machines to produce small-batch and personalized metal products, ranging from home décor to industrial prototypes.
Conclusion
Fiber laser cutting machines have become an essential technology across a wide range of industries, from automotive and aerospace to electronics, construction, and custom fabrication. Their ability to deliver high precision, fast processing speeds, and flexible production capabilities makes them a cornerstone of modern manufacturing.
As industries continue to evolve toward automation and intelligent manufacturing, fiber laser cutting technology will play an even more important role in improving productivity, reducing costs, and enabling innovative product design.
